Tragedy on Stuttgart's Streets: Mother and Two Children Killed After Being Struck by Car

Heartbreaking Incident Leaves Community in Mourning

A tragic incident on the streets of Esslingen bei Stuttgart has left a family shattered and a community in mourning. Three pedestrians, a mother and her two young children, were tragically killed after being struck by a car on Tuesday evening.

The family was walking along a busy road when the accident occurred. The driver of the car, a 62-year-old man, reportedly lost control of his vehicle, swerving onto the sidewalk and hitting the pedestrians.

Emergency Services Respond, Victims Pronounced Dead

Emergency services quickly arrived at the scene and transported the victims to the hospital, where they were pronounced dead. The mother, 37-year-old Julia H., and her two children, 6-year-old Sophia H. and 8-year-old Max H., succumbed to their injuries.

The driver of the car has been taken into custody and is facing charges of negligent homicide.

Community Grieves for Lost Lives

The news of the tragedy has sent shockwaves through the Esslingen bei Stuttgart community. Residents and local authorities have expressed their deepest condolences to the victims' family.

A memorial service is being planned to honor the memory of the deceased. The community is also rallying together to provide support to the victims' family during this difficult time.

Investigation Underway as Questions Linger

The police are conducting a thorough investigation to determine the exact cause of the accident. The driver's condition at the time of the incident is being examined, and witnesses are being interviewed.

The community is seeking answers and demanding accountability for the tragic loss of life. As the investigation progresses, more details are expected to emerge about the circumstances surrounding the accident.
